The jQuery Ajax async is handling Asynchronous HTTP requests in the element. The jQuery $.ajax () function is used to perform an asynchronous HTTP request. Its a way of communication between the client and server without reloading the web page again and again. If the POST method is required, the method can be specified by setting a value for the type option. In this article, we looked at three ways to make AJAX post requests in a web application. AJAX is a set of web development techniques used by client-side frameworks and libraries to make asynchronous HTTP calls to the server. Step 2. This is a shorthand Ajax function, which is equivalent to: 1 2 3 4 5 6 7 $.ajax ( { It is a function to working on a server without associating more than on request. The code will stop at the await keyword and wait for the AJAX request to come back with a response. Closed 8 years ago. The basic . Synchronous and asynchronous requests. using post method send data in datatable ajax. GET and POST Requests with AJAX Asynchronous JavaScript and XML (AJAX) enables web applications to send and retrieve data from a server asynchronously. Set easyHTTP.prototype.post to a function which contains three parameters 'url', data and callback. A simple challenge is how to launch a request and return the result from an AMD module. Cross-domain requests and dataType: "jsonp" requests do not support synchronous operation. JQuery Ajax POST Method. The jQuery ajax request can be performed with the help of the ajax () function. It is an Asynchronous method to send HTTP requests without waiting response. It was added to the library a long time ago, existing since version 1.0. onload - js event - body event - event Element.insertAdjacentElement() - beforebegin - afterend - beforeend - afterbegin - insert node element Create HTML using JavaScript Adding HTML to the page - append insertAdjacentHTML - DOM - Insert HTML - Add html tag JavaScript Fetch API - Ajax - Request JavaScript Fetch API - Async Await - Ajax JavaScript Essentials - Types - Tests - Vars - Variables . It contains two methods currently, wp.ajax.post () and wp.ajax.send (). Possible names/values in the table below: Name Value/Description; async . These are similar to Action methods of ASP.NET MVC or WEB API. It normally uses XML, plain text or JSON to communicate with server i.e. All properties except for url are optional. I'm going to focus this article on wp.ajax.send () because wp.ajax.post () is really just a wrapper around the send method that ensures the request is sent as a POST request. By default, Ajax requests are sent using the GET HTTP method. The keystone of AJAX is the XMLHttpRequest object. Phn trn mnh vit demo nh th mi ngi thy c cch x dng ng b v bt ng b mt cch n . Its a general convention to use the POST method to send the data to server & server creates new resources received in the request body. This means that a user can still interact with a page while the app uses JavaScript to fetch information from the server and update the page. The request method in Ajax and the difference between synchronous asynchronous Request, divided into get and post: GET The most common HTTP request, the ordinary Internet browsing page is Get. Create an XMLHttpRequest object ; Define a callback function; Open the XMLHttpRequest object; Send a Request to a server; The XMLHttpRequest Object. Its general form is: url : is the only mandatory parameter. A default can be set for any option with $.ajaxSetup (). The returned data will be ignored if no other parameter is specified. The working of the ajax delete request On the Contact page after filling in all information and click Submit button, I submit that form by using Ajax. This kind of behaviour is all over the show online. All modern browsers support the XMLHttpRequest object. Synchronous requests block the execution of code which causes "freezing" on the screen and an unresponsive user experience. The parameter request of the GET method is directly followed by the URL,. It is a procedure to send a request to the server without interruption. Step 3. Despite sending an async request to the server over AJAX, the server will not respond until the previous unrelated request has finished. axios post result in node. The Razor Page. In general, however, asynchronous requests should be preferred to synchronous requests for performance reasons. All jQuery AJAX methods use the ajax() method. Sends an asynchronous http POST request to load data from the server. AJAX is a technique used for making asynchronous requests from the browser to the server for various purposes including posting form values. Making a POST request is a little different to a GET request. Javascript has fetch API that can be used to POST/GET a FORM to an ASP.NET Core application on the server side. With the jQuery AJAX methods, you can request text, HTML, XML, or JSON from a remote server using both HTTP Get and HTTP Post and you can load the external data directly into the selected HTML elements of your web page. A set of key/value pairs that configure the Ajax request. The $.ajax . The XMLHttpRequest object can be used to exchange data with a web server behind the scenes. Ajax and Ajax Requests AJAX stands for Asynchronous JavaScript and XML. Type will automatically be set to POST. The jQuery's $.get () and $.post () methods provide simple tools to send and retrieve data asynchronously from a web server. Using the XMLHttpRequest API. You can see the code below: You can see the code below: The same function handles any . See jQuery.ajax ( settings ) for a complete list of all settings. An AJAX request basically just allows us to communicate with a server. this is set to true by default). Syntax: $.post ( URL,data,callback ); The required URL parameter specifies the URL you wish to request. In the example code, the async keyword is used to make the getSuggestions () function an async function. Making a POST AJAX Request. Open Visual Studio and Create project. In simpler words, you can use Ajax to load data from backend without actually the page reloading. The possible values for the type option are GET, POST, PUT, and DELETE. xmlhttprequest ajax header pass in javascript. Any asynchronous Ajax request performed by Webix returns a promiseobject that is resolved when server response arrives. Syntax $.ajax({name:value, name:value, . }) AJAX AJAX is a web technology used in client-side to perform an asynchronous HTTP request. Step 5. Handle Ajax Requests in ASP.NET Core Razor Pages. See how it is implemented in Webix data loadingpattern. The ajax() method is used to perform an AJAX (asynchronous HTTP) request. data : A plain object or string that is sent to the server . Pre-Requirements The $.post () method requests data from the server using an HTTP POST request. Synchronous Request To execute a synchronous request, change the third parameter in the open () method to false: xhttp.open("GET", "ajax_info.txt", false); Sometimes async = false are used for quick testing. Simply, we can use AJAX to fetch data from a server without reloading a page (If you don't like the term AJAX, remember is as fetching data from APIs, no rocket science). Even though AJAX holds XML in the name, the way data is sent through requests or received doesn't have to be XML, but also plain text, or in most cases JSON, due to it being lighter and a part of . Install Laravel Project. Ajax http request example May 8, 2018 by admin Ajax refers to asynchronous java script and xml. composer create-project laravel / laravel laravel - ajax -crud --prefer-dist. Linking an Ajax Request to an "OnPost" handler . sending post request using ajax. jQuery Ajax Post method, or shorthand, $.post () method makes asynchronous requests to the web server using the HTTP POST method and loads data from the server as the response in the form of HTML, XML, JSON, etc. We first make an instance of XMLHttpRequest. The optional data parameter specifies some data to send along with the request. sending get json to a get request axios. The default value is GET which sends the GET request. The following snippet shows how a single line of javascript fetch function can be used to send an AJAX request to OnPostAsync function on the server side. This article guides you through the Ajax basics and gives you two simple hands-on examples to get you started. This means that the function will return a promise. Using the instance we can trigger the XHR call and get the response. send post rquest. xhr.open (methodType, URL, async); Here we say, that we want to connect to "URL". If you need synchronous requests, set this option to false. Steps required to make library.js File: In library.js file, make a function easyHTTP to initialize a new XMLHttpRequest () method. AJAX stands for Asynchronous JavaScript And XML, which allows the webpage to be updated in the backgroud without refreshing the page. The jQuery ajax () function is a built-in function in jQuery. GET/POST data requests among the clients and servers, is a prime requirement in every PHP project. This call will start a background process and it waits for it to complete so it can display the final . for data transfer. javascript ajax post send an object basic post in ajax jquery ajax $.post with data javascript send post data with ajax make ajax request post jquery jquery post method json ajax post http jqueyr ajax post data send post ajax ajax post ajax ajax post method\ ajax jquery post data pass data in post ajax request ajax post values post ajax jquery example Request Body ajax post what is get and . XMLHttpRequest supports both synchronous and asynchronous communications. Now open an object using this.http.open function. Note: Ajax is technology independent. Head over to project directory, or you can simultaneously execute following command with above command. Vue asynchronous request get and post get request post request . By using then()method, you can get to the response data. The XMLHttpRequest API is the core of Ajax. This option affects how the contents of the data option are sent to the server. In the above format, the first parameter is "type . AJAX stands for Asynchronous Javascript And XML. This section covers asynchronous form submission from a Razor Page using both the jQuery AJAX capability and the Fetch API. when to write xhttp or other value in ajax open ,method. <p> AJAX stands for Asynchronous JavaScript And XML. It's an asynchronous function, meaning it runs the code and doesn't stop the rest of the app from working. Select the ASP.Net Core MVC and click on Next. What we expect is our modules can return the result from the HTTP request. POST data will always be transmitted to the server using UTF-8 charset, per the W3C XMLHTTPRequest standard. The parameters specifies one or more name/value pairs for the AJAX request. </p> You will learn more about onreadystatechange in a later chapter. The $.ajax () Function. Using AJAX you can either request, receive or send the data to server. Give the project name and location of your project. example: // Elsewhere in code, inside an async function const stuff = await doAjax(); The other option is to use the Promise interface and roll that way: doAjax().then( (data) => doStuff( data) ) AJAX stands for " A synchronous J avaScript and X ML". Later we'll use the Fetch API t. This article will explain how to use some Ajax techniques, like: Analyzing and manipulating the response of the server. Stack Overflow Public questions & answers;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Talent Build your employer brand ; Advertising Reach developers & technologists worldwide; About the company This string contains the adress to which to send the request. What we expect is our modules can . This means that it is possible to update parts of . Razor Pages are a new feature of ASP.NET Core that makes coding page-focused scenarios easier and more productive. Return value - The ajax type option does not return any value. A POST contains a body of data that is sent . Given below is the sample of a POST request sent to the server using ajax. Ajax is of Asynchronous type. Select Target Framework .NET 5.0. We can make an HTTP request to retrieve data without reloading the page from that server which we can then use in our code. get request with authorization header with axios. Both the methods are pretty much identical, apart from one major difference the $.get () makes Ajax requests using the HTTP GET method, whereas the $.post () makes Ajax requests using the HTTP POST method. Cn khi ta st async:false ngha l ang hm ajax chy ng b, khi hm ajax chy xong v ly c gi tr vo listCountry mi chy tip xung consolog.log th ng nhin l s success ri. React - Ajax POST request React - Google Ads / GPT with fluid size on web page React - Material-UI Select component with array of objects React - add / remove items from array in state (class component) React - add / remove items from array in state (functional component) React - add attributes to dynamic tag name React - add onClick to div AJAX Intro AJAX XMLHttp AJAX Request AJAX Response AJAX XML File AJAX PHP AJAX ASP AJAX Database AJAX Applications AJAX Examples JS JSON JSON Intro JSON Syntax JSON vs XML JSON Data Types JSON Parse JSON Stringify JSON Objects JSON Arrays JSON Server JSON PHP JSON HTML JSON JSONP JS vs jQuery jQuery Selectors jQuery HTML jQuery CSS jQuery DOM JS Graphics JS Graphics JS Canvas JS Plotly JS . Visit our Facebook page; Visit our Twitter account; Visit our Instagram account; Visit our LinkedIn account The PageModel for this example includes a property called InputModel, which encapsulates the values to be bound . Razor pages use handler methods to deal with the incoming HTTP request (GET/POST/PUT/Delete). The XMLHttpRequest object is a key factor of AJAX, this object lets you send and retrieve XML data and other formats such as JSON from a server without refreshing the page. Beyond the request type, both .send and .post work almost the same. The async await syntax is used with the Fetch API to handle promises. Hey gang, in this Async JavaScript tutorial we'll take a look at what HTTP requests are and how they are made under the hood. This method is mostly used for requests where the other methods cannot be used. Monitoring the progress of a request. Asynchronous Javascript and XML (AJAX), is a way of communicating to a web server from a client-side application through the HTTP or HTTPS protocol. The await keyword used before the fetch () call makes the code wait until the promise is resolved. AJAX is a modern web technology used for updating page contents asynchronously. The ajax () function is used to perform an asynchronous HTTP request to the server, and it also allows to send or get the data asynchronously without reloading the web page, which makes it fast. We have to run the given below command to install a fresh Laravel application, this app will be the sacred canon for Laravel Ajax example. The first option is to make sure that you use await when calling doAjax () later on. This XML part is the data that we are retrieving. In this tutorial, we will learn how to make AJAX HTTP GET and POST requests from Django templates. React and AJAX It is used to specify the type of asynchronous HTTP request sent. It is not a not a programming language. By default, all requests are sent asynchronously (i.e. The following code is only broken in this way on Nginx, but runs perfectly on Apache. Step 4. Step1.

Trendspot Ceramic Planter 10 Dia Blue Rivage, Madoka Magica Crossover Fanfiction, Soundcloud Playlist Organizer, Wrestling Awards 2022, Maybank2u Classic Login, Math 2 Unpacking Document, Import Pytorch Google Colab,